This is Turtle.

You have to understand one thing here about Home Depot on selling thermostats. Home Depot does not have a standard stock of different type thermostats to keep in stock but has a deal cut with Honeywell / White Rogers / Maple Chace -- Robert Shaw and agree to sell any over manufactored number of therostats that are supplied to Home Depot. H.D. may at any time have a large supply or a no supply of a model of thermostats because of the supply agreement. Now they do get a discount Over wholesale on the price by taking these overages of thermostats.

So what supply they have may change from day to day by supply agreements and to see them there they must have a somewhat over supply by the manufactor of that model . As you say the Honeywell CT-8602 is out of supply well just wait for another over supply.
